Starting a Small Business Loan Options: Finding the Right Fit for You
Securing funding for your small business venture can be a tricky process. There are many loan options offered, each with its own distinct terms and conditions.
To enhance your chances of funding, it's essential to carefully investigate the different types of loans and assess which one best suits your individual needs.
Here are a few frequently used loan options for small businesses:
* **Term Loans:** These loans grant a lump sum of money that you settle over a fixed duration.
* **Lines of Credit:** This versatile option enables you to borrow funds as needed, up to a predetermined limit.
* **SBA Loans:** Backed by the Small Business Administration, these loans often include beneficial interest rates and settlement terms.
* **Microloans:** These small loans are aimed for startups and businesses with limited experience.

Acquiring Small Business Loans
Navigating the realm of small business loans can be daunting, especially for business owners just beginning out. It's crucial to understand the various loan avenues available, each with its specific terms. From traditional bank loans to non-traditional funding sources, exploring your choices thoroughly is essential.
Before requesting for a loan, it's vital to formulate a thorough business plan outlining your aspirations, financial forecasts, and repayment strategy. This showcases your credibility to lenders and increases your probability of loan approval.
When choosing a lender, consider factors such as interest rates, repayment terms, expenses, and customer support.
